Technical Skills
  • Programming: Has ability to write secure code in three or more languages -Java, JavaScript, SQL (Oracle); familiar with secure coding standards (e.g.OWASP, CWE, SEI CERT) and vulnerabilities
  • Programming: Understands internal of operating systems (Windows, Linux, Mainframe) to write interoperable and performant code; able to perform debugging and troubleshooting to analyze core, heap, thread dumps and remove coding errors; understands cryptography techniques and libraries to build secure communication and user authentication/authorization (e.g. OAuth1.0a, SAML, GnuTLS, OpenSSL, PKCS#11, CryptLib, JCA/JCP, JWT/JWS/JWE)
  • Development Practices: Understands and implements standard branching (e.g.Gitflow) and peer review practices; Apply tools (e.g.Sonar, Zally, Checkmarx) and techniques to scan and measure code quality and anti-patterns as part of development activity; understands and builds test code at unit level, service level, and integration level to ensure code and functional coverage
  • Development Practices: Able to apply DRY (Don't Repeat Yourself) principle to enable common library development for enterprise-wide reuse; has skills in test driven and behavior driven development (TDD and BDD) to build just enough code and collaborate on the desired functionality; has skills to author test code with lots of smaller tests followed by few contract tests at service level and fewer journey tests at the integration level (Test Pyramid concepts
  • Patterns and Frameworks: Understands theuse of basic design patterns (e.g.factory, adaptor, singleton, composite, observer, strategy, inversion of control); has skills inbuilding applications using open frameworks to achieve reuse and reduce development times (e.g.Spring Boot, Steeltoe, Angular, DXP, others)
  • Patterns and Frameworks: Understand use cases for advanced design patterns (e.g. service-to-worker, MVC, API gateway, intercepting filter, dependency injection, lazy loading, all from gang of four) to implement efficient code; understands and implements Application Programming Interface (API) standards and cataloging to drive API/service adoption and commercialization

  • Planning: Has skills to collaborate with team and business stakeholders to estimate requirements (e.g. story pointing) and prioritize based on business value; understands work classification to determine software capitalization opportunities; has skills to elaborate and estimate non-functional requirements, including security (e.g. data protection, authentication, authorization), regulatory, and performance (SLAs, throughput, transactions per second)
  • Practices and Metrics: Has skills to understand, report, and optimize delivery metrics to continuously improve upon them (e.g. velocity, throughput, lead time, defect leakage, burndown); has skills to document and drive definition-of-done for requirements to meet both business and operational needs; understands cost of defects and implements a well-defined defect life cycle to minimize defect leakage and improve customer and operational experience; has skills to conduct product demos and co-ordinate with product owners to drive product acceptance sign-offs
  • Engineering Principles: Understand the basic tenets of buildingand runningmission critical software capabilities (security, customer experience, testing, operability, simplification, service-oriented architecture)
  • Engineering Principles: Has skills to implement and govern data protection at rest and transit to meet regulatory needs (e.g. PCI DSS, GDPR); has skills to understand customer journeys and ensure customer good experience by continuously reducing Mean time to mitigate (MTTM) for incidents and ensuring high availability (99.95% as a starting point); has skills to simplify deployment and eliminate software and infrastructure snowflakes using standardized platforms, ephemeral instances, and automation
  • Patterns and Protocols: Understands encryption and digital signature standards and patterns (e.g. symmetric/secret-key - AES, public key, and hashing - SHA-2 and SHA-3) and recommend software or hardware (HSM) implementation solutions; has skills to implement authentication and authorization patterns depending on use cases (e.g. RBAC, multi-factor, SSO, biometric)
  • Automation: Has skills to orchestrate release workflows and pipelines, and apply standardized pipelines via APIs to achieve CI and CD using industry standard tools (e.g. Jenkins, Bamboo, AWS/Azure pipelines, XL Release, others); able to configure rules and build automation for code with vulnerability scanning and software composition analysis using standard tools (e.g. Sonar, Checkmarx, Nexus, JFrog XRay, Veracode, others); manage builds and artifacts leveraging standard tools (e.g. Artifactory) to ensure error-free deployment of production code using canary and blue-green techniques
  • Performance and Observability: Has skills to implement standard logging and event correlation for business transactions and security events for faster troubleshooting and compliance; familiar with adoption of standard logging frameworks and tools (e.g. log4j, SLF4J, Splunk) to aggregate and analyze time-series of logs; has skills to build monitoring and ing focusing on key signals (resource usage, threshold breaches, rate of change) by using industry standard tools (e.g. Dynatrace, Netcool/OMNIbus, OpenTracing)
  • Test Strategy: Follows customer testing standards via the Test Strategy; has skills to author test cases leveraging behavior driven development and customer journey concepts; understand organization of testing artifacts (e.g. test folders, sets, runs) in ALM tools and link them to automated testing code to report status of test runs
  • Testing Types: Understand functional and non-functional testing types and elaborate and estimate test efforts; understand how to build and automate robust tests to minimize defect leakage by performing regression, performance, deployment verification, and release testing
  • Platform as a Service (PAAS) /Function as a Service (FAAS): Understands general concepts around PAAS and FAAS, and building applications that can be hosted on any standardized on-prem/public or private cloud environments
  • Containerization: Shows basic knowledge of containers, how they work, and their interaction with applications and other systems on the platform
